Networking

  • I'm having trouble acquiring a DHCP lease. I believe it has something to do with the DHCP configuration, but for now I'm manually assigning an IP address.

/etc/network/interfaces:

iface eth0 inet static
address 192.168.1.138
network 192.168.1.1
netmask 255.255.255.0
broadcast 192.168.1.255

Add default route

route add default gw 192.168.1.1 eth0

Edit rc#.d to run, because ifup -a only brings up interfaces assigned with auto

ifup eth0
